As a social worker at a pediatric hospital for the last 7 years, I have had the honor and privilege to be seen as a safe and compassionate support for children, adolescents, and families during times of stress, trauma, and grief. With a trauma-informed Solution-Focused therapeutic lens, I have worked closely with individuals in acute distress from an assault or a new diagnosis. I also have significant experience working with LGBTQ+ youth and neurodivergent youth around exploring identities and how those identities impact their interactions with family and in their day to day lives.

From my experience as a trauma-informed solution-focused social worker, I have learned the importance of client centered care. I will meet you where you are at in life and tailor my therapeutic techniques towards the goals that you set. I will provide a safe and supportive space while utilizing therapeutic techniques,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Solution Focused Brief Therapy, and mindfulness techniques, to help reduce symptoms of depression, stress and anxiety.

I identify as a queer, white, cisgender, able-bodied social worker. I am actively engaging in anti-racist and disability justice work, as well as support of transgender rights in a professional setting as well as in my day to day life.
